( use this for part 3 only) If you are not familiar here is what the Three Principles of Film Form means:
The three fundamental principles of film form are:
Movies depend on light to create an image on screen, Movies provide an illusion of movement by rapidly displaying still frames, Movies can manipulate space and time through cinematic techniques.
Explanation:
1- Light dependency:Since the camera captures light to create an image, lighting is crucial for every shot, influencing the visual appearance and mood of a scene.
2- Illusion of movement:The rapid projection of individual still images (frames) tricks the human eye into perceiving continuous motion.
3- Space and time manipulation:Filmmakers can use camera angles, editing techniques, and other cinematic tools to alter how viewers perceive space and time within a scene
